What is Bird?
Bird (formerly MessageBird) is a cloud communications platform that offers SMS, voice, chat, and video capabilities. It focuses on enabling omnichannel communication for businesses, allowing them to connect with customers across various channels seamlessly.
What is PubNub?
PubNub is a developer API platform that powers the realtime infrastructure in apps to build engaging Virtual Spaces where online communities can connect. It can serve as the foundation for online chat, live events, geolocation, remote IoT control, and realtime updates.

Scalability | |||
Concurrent connections | Number of users that can be supported in a single chat. | Bird Unknown. | PubNub 10,000 users can be supported in a single chat. They recommend you limit the number of online users in a single chat room or space to 10,000 users for optimal performance. |
Connections | Number of connections that can be handled across the platform. | Bird Unknown. | PubNub Unlimited. Overages apply if you exceed plan quota - $0.15 per additional user. |
Channels / rooms | Number of channels or rooms that can be handled across the platform. | Bird Unlimited. | PubNub Unlimited. |
Messages | Number of messages that can be handled across the platform. | Bird Unlimited. | PubNub Unlimited. Overages apply if you exceed 3000 per user - $43 per additional 1M transactions. |
Message throughput | Number of messsages that can be published per second. | Bird Not publicly disclosed. | PubNub 10-15 messages per second can be published. Read more |

Ecosystem support | |||
Supported realtime protocols | Support for multiple protocols provides the flexibility to choose a protocol that best suits your project’s requirements. | Bird Bird uses SMPP (Short Message Peer-to-Peer) for SMS messaging. Read more | PubNub
PubNub uses HTTP as the transport for their client libraries. A WebSocket compliant interface is provided in some libraries, however this is just a wrapper around an underlying HTTP transport. |

Pricing | |||
Pricing model | The pricing model should align with your project's expected load, usage patterns, and budget in order to be cost-effective and efficient. | Bird Bird pricing is based on your targeted monthly contacts (unique user interactions per month on the app). Read more | PubNub PubNub offers Free, Starter, and Pro packages. Their support packages, separate from their standard plans, also include an Enterprise option. Their pricing model is based on monthly active users (MAUs). See the pricing page |
Pricing illustration | An example price based on 5 live streaming chat events and 50K attendees. | Bird Unable to confirm that 25k concurrent connections can be supported in a single group. Bird is best suited to 1:1 or small group chats. | PubNub $23,048.00
Note: Assumes same users attend each event to keep MAU at minimum. PubNub pricing page |
